Scottish Rugby secures front-of-shirt deal with Arnold Clark

As part of the deal, Arnold Clark has been labelled Scottish Rugby's principal partner.

spot_img

The governing body of rugby union in Scotland, Scottish Rugby has announced a multi-year partnership with Arnold Clark, Europe’s largest independent car retailer.

As part of the deal, the brand has been labelled the sporting body’s principal partner. Moreover, the Scottish-based company’s emblem will be prominently placed on the front-of-shirt of the famed Scotland men’s team for both home and away games.

The brand is widely recognised in Scotland and continues to expand, with branches in England and the recent opening of its first facility in Wales. Over the years, the brand has made significant investments in grassroots sports, supplying kits and other resources to young sports teams through the Arnold Clark Community Fund. This initiative will be continued in the new Scottish Rugby collaboration with the title sponsorship of the Premiership Rugby and Premiership Women’s Rugby (PWR) and National Leagues beginning in the 2024-25 campaign.

Fans will get a firsthand look at the new front-of-shirt sponsorship when the Scotland uniform is revealed on August 2. Furthermore, Scotland women’s new season outfit design will also be shown, along with its current and first-ever, distinctive front-of-shirt sponsor, Scottish Gas, which was confirmed in July 2023.
